-
If we want to be able to stabalize this crate and release a v1.0 we either have to stabalize `secp256k1_sys` or remove all the `ffi` types from the public API.
Since the `secp256k1_sys` crate may…
-
The existing tests and sample use `tiny-secp256k1`, however this lib might not be well suited for every one.
Request:
- add an `ECC` example that implements the `TinySecp256k1Interface` but does …
-
### Is there an existing issue for this?
- [X] I have searched the existing issues
### What happened?
Valid secp256k1 public keys are typically 33-bytes long and begin with a SEC1 tag byte: e…
-
We should also probably make `AlignedType` contain `MaybeUninit` or something like that, as the C code might write padding bytes to it.
I think it wasn't stable (enough) back when I i…
-
A comment in `secp256k1/secp256k1.h` says:
```с
/** Opaque data structure that holds context information (precomputed tables etc.).
*
* The purpose of context structures is to cache large pre…
-
I'm using just the `@node-lightning/invoice` package in a project, importing version `0.28.0`. The problem happens when I try to run a unit test and is the following:
```
Loading jest.config.js.…
-
Removing the define of this variable in `build.rs` doesn't seem to do anything. What does this var do?
### Context
```rust
// Actual build
let mut base_config = cc::Build::new();
…
-
Hi,
# What
I am trying to modify the encrypt, decrypt and keygen modules to support SECP256K1 and AES-GCM 256, but the decryption fails.
# Why
Since most of the publicly available implementati…
-
As has been noted in the [@web5/crypto package](https://github.com/TBD54566975/web5-js/blob/91d52aaa9410db5e5f7c3c31ebfe0d4956028496/packages/crypto/src/primitives/secp256k1.ts#L779), support for low-…
-
hello,
in this sawtooth sdk I do not see any use of secp256k1,
by this fact, I do not understand how are signed messages .
can someone enlighten me about this ?
akitl updated
4 years ago